1986 Toyota Pickup — FAQ

Answers based on real NHTSA complaint and recall data for this specific model year.

Is the 1986 Toyota Pickup reliable?
Verdict: Typical for Model. The 1986 Toyota Pickup has 20 NHTSA complaints, 1 crash-related, and 0 recall campaigns. The most common issue is Tire Defects with 5 complaints. Source: NHTSA via VinItel.
What are common problems with the 1986 Toyota Pickup?
Top reported problems: Tire Defects (5 complaints, avg 98,000 mi); Body Structure (3 complaints); Structural Problems (2 complaints). Every complaint is filed by an owner with NHTSA — this is raw reported data, not editorial opinion.
At what mileage do problems start on the 1986 Toyota Pickup?
The weighted average mileage at time of complaint is about 98,000 miles. Some components fail earlier, some later — check the "All Problems by Category" table above for per-issue averages.
How safe is the 1986 Toyota Pickup?
NHTSA complaints for the 1986 Toyota Pickup include 1 crash-related reports, 0 fire reports, 0 injuries, and 0 fatalities. These are owner-reported incidents, not official crash-test ratings — a complaint being filed doesn't confirm a defect, but clusters around specific components are worth investigating.
Does the 1986 Toyota Pickup have any recalls?
No NHTSA recall campaigns have been issued for the 1986 Toyota Pickup as of the latest data sync. Verify by VIN for the most current status — new recalls can be issued years after a model year ships.
Should I buy a 1986 Toyota Pickup?
Complaint levels are in line with what's expected. Normal used-car due diligence applies — check the specific VIN for accident history, open recalls, and title brands.
